WebHoward Hughes. Howard Hughes had always been eccentric. The billionaire business mogul and aviator had obsessive-compulsive tendencies; once, during a movie shoot, he became so fixated on a flaw in one of Jane Russell's blouses that he designed a unique kind of underwire bra to fix the problem. Web1 de jul. de 2005 · Howard Hughes--the billionaire aviator, motion-picture producer and business tycoon--spent most of his life trying to avoid germs. Toward the end of his life, he lay naked in bed in darkened hotel rooms in what he considered a germ-free zone. He wore tissue boxes on his feet to protect them. Web19 de jan. de 2024 · On July 7, 1946, Howard Hughes was performing the first flight of the XF-11, which was meant for the United States Army Forces. Unfortunately, the plane sprang an oil leak, which caused the propellers to reverse their pitch. Howard Hughes' … the purity of a light wave corresponds to itsWebThis is likely because Hughes was never formally diagnosed with any mental illness. However, the evidence gathered by Fowler suggests that Hughes was suffering from OCD, depression, and anxiety.
